One of the world's best mesh Wi-Fi systems, the Orbi WiFi 6E from Netgear (model number RBKE963) is also one of the priciest. However, if you have a large house, a gigabit internet connection from your ISP, and a lot of money to burn, this mesh system is probably for you.

The Orbi WiFi 6E has a 9,000 square foot coverage area. You can reach 12,000 square feet by adding a third satellite. The router's 6-GHz channel generated throughput of more than a gigabit per second at a distance of 15 feet, making it the first mesh router to accomplish so in our tests.

Trial versions of Netgear's Armor security software, which incorporates Bitdefender antivirus and parental controls, are available. After 90 days, tech support is also chargeable. You won't mind if you can afford to pay for this mesh system, though.

What distinguishes a mesh Wi-Fi network from a traditional router?

Your broadband/fiber connections are served by a single access point provided by traditional Wi-Fi routers. However, if too many connections are established at once, this may result in bottlenecks and have an effect on how reliable a connection is.

When the number of connections is manageable, traditional routers frequently provide better power and speed compared to mesh, but mesh gives more access points and more extensive, all-encompassing coverage.

Because of this, wired and traditional routers are frequently preferable for gaming and streaming, although mesh is a good choice when there are many users and connections in a home.

Is it worthwhile to upgrade from Wi-Fi 5 (802.11ac) to Wi-Fi 6 (802.11ax)?

Yes, if you are ready to pay up front for a better connection. An update to Wi-Fi 6 allows you access to more streams and perhaps speedier services in an era where smartphones, IoT devices, and streaming services rule the world.

Where should my Wi-Fi router be placed?

You should install your Wi-Fi router in a somewhat central area of your home for the best range and coverage. In addition to providing improved coverage, a central location minimizes the amount of walls and other obstructions that the Wi-Fi signal must pass through.

Avoid installing your router in the kitchen or your home theater since their signals could interfere with one another. You'll also want to avoid placing it next to other equipment.
